The BSN degree requirements include: taking five 6-credit Nursing courses (30 credits must be taken at UMass Boston), completing all health science pre-requisites (whether taken at UMass Boston or not), meeting all required general education, distribution, statistics, and elective pre-requisite courses, completing the writing proficiency requirement, and taking 120 overall credits (including accepted Transfer and RN Licensure credits).
